昨晚凌晨两点,刚改完一个客户的移动端页面,眼睛酸得厉害,顺手点了根烟。看着满屏的代码,突然想聊聊最近很多人问我的一个问题:现在都2024年了,搞网站建设html5还有必要吗?是不是都在割韭菜?
说句不好听的大实话,如果你还在用那种十年前的模板建站,或者指望找个外包公司花几千块弄个“响应式”就万事大吉,那你大概率是在交智商税。我入行十年,见过太多老板花冤枉钱,最后网站打开慢得像蜗牛,百度蜘蛛爬都爬不动。
咱们先别扯那些高大上的技术名词,就说说最现实的痛点。为什么你的网站在手机上看排版全乱?为什么图片加载要转圈圈?为什么百度收录那么慢?很多时候,根子就在底层架构上。
很多人以为html5就是几个新标签,比如
我拿前年做的一个企业官网案例来说。客户是做机械设备的,以前那个站,PC端看着还行,手机端直接崩了。图片全是PS压过后的,代码里堆砌了无数层div嵌套,也就是我们行话说的“屎山代码”。后来我重新给他做了html5重构,效果怎么样?
第一步,语义化重构。
别再用满屏的div了。用
第二步,媒体查询与自适应布局。
html5配合CSS3的Media Queries,能实现真正的“一次开发,多端适配”。注意,是适配,不是简单的缩放。我见过很多同行,为了省事,直接搞个移动端跳转链接,结果PC和手机内容不一致,被百度判定为作弊,直接降权。用html5做流体网格布局,根据屏幕宽度自动调整元素大小,这才是正解。
第三步,性能优化,这是最关键的。
html5原生支持
再说说成本。很多人觉得html5开发贵。其实不然。如果前期架构搭得好,后期维护成本极低。以前那种硬编码的页面,改个字体、换个颜色都要动底层代码,容易出Bug。html5结构清晰,改起来就像改Word文档一样方便。
当然,也不是所有项目都需要上html5。如果你是做个简单的临时活动页,撑死活三天,那随便搞搞就行。但如果你是做企业官网、品牌展示,甚至是有电商属性的网站,html5是底线,不是加分项。
我有个同行,前年接了个单子,为了省钱没用html5,结果上线后兼容性差得要死,在iPhone上按钮点不动,安卓上文字重叠。客户投诉电话打爆了他的手机,最后不仅没拿到尾款,还赔了违约金。这种亏本买卖,千万别干。
最后给个建议。找建站公司或者自己开发时,别光问“支不支持手机访问”,要问“是否采用语义化标签”、“是否做了首屏优化”、“是否兼容主流浏览器内核”。如果对方支支吾吾,或者说“差不多就行”,那趁早换人。
网站建设html5不是新技术,它是现在的标准配置。别等网站被降权了,才想起来后悔。
本文关键词:网站建设html5